
Elizete Cardoso - Cancao Do Amor Demais
Born in Rio de Janeiro, Elizete Cardoso (1920-1990) was one of the best-known voices of Bossa Nova. She enjoyed considerable success and popularity. In 1958, Cardoso was invited by Vinícius de Moraes to sing on an album featuring tunes he co-wrote with Antônio Carlos Jobim. The result, Canção do Amor Demais, presented here in its entirety,was one of her biggest hits and the earliest proper Bossa Nova
